junior-miss
Noun
/ˈdʒuːn.jər mɪs/

Definition
A title used to refer to a young girl, typically between the ages of 6 and 14, often in the context of beauty pageants or social events.

Examples
She was crowned the junior-miss at the local pageant last year.
The junior-miss participants wore beautiful dresses and showcased their talents on stage.

Meaning
The term ‘junior-miss’ is generally associated with young girls who participate in beauty contests aimed specifically at their age group, promoting poise, skills, and confidence.
